CCAP Help Desk - Security Forms
Access to all CCAP systems requires a signed security form. In an effort to maximize resources and provide better service, the CCAP Help Desk is streamlining its system access request procedures. With the exception of a few site administered providers, all CCAP provider staff should be accessing IPACS, CCTS, and SAMS through Web3270/Blue Zone. As such, the CCAP Help Desk will no longer issue RACF IDS for new staff if the Web3270 information is not also included on the 4052 form. All CCAP system access needs must be requested at the same time for new staff. Please remember to include the security role.
CCMS Preview!
Have you created your agency teams in the training environment? Have you e-mailed or scanned documents into the CCMS? If so, you are ready for routing!

From the Administration tab, click the Manage Routing tab on the left. There are additional tabs near the top of this page. We've selected County for the BCCD Eligibility Team. This team will only process applications from Adams, Alexander and Bond Counties. You may select more Counties from the left and use the > arrows to add or delete counties in the right column.
